              <text>Reconfigurable Intelligent Surfaces (RIS) have strong potential to improve the performance of time-varying Internet of Things (IoT) networks. However, a major challenge in operating RIS effectively is the need for frequent Quantized Phase Configuration (QPC) feedback bits from the Base Station (BS) to the controller. This challenge becomes more serious asthe RIS size grows, since the feedback bandwidth is limited. As a result, efficient compression of control signals is crucial for the practical deployment of RIS. In this work, we propose Bayesian Optimized Residual Convolutional AutoEncoder (BORCAE), a lightweight and noise-resilient feedback compression framework based on a 1D Convolutional Autoencoder with residual connections. The model is designed to reduce QPC feedback size while preserving high reconstruction fidelity. To ensure adaptability across varying deployment conditions, we employ Bayesian hyperparameter optimization using Optuna, which enables automatic tuning of key architectural hyperparameters. This optimization ensures that the architecture generalizes effectively across a wide range of operating scenarios. Additionally, we integrate the Limited Memory Broyden Fletcher Goldfarb Shanno (LBFGS) optimizer during the final training epochs, which accelerates convergence and improves stability. For performance evaluation, we use Normalized Mean Squared Error (NMSE) as the reconstruction metric. Extensive testing across different Signal-to-Interference-plus-Noise Ratio (SINR) levels demonstrates that BORCAE consistently achieves lower NMSE compared to DL-CsiNet and CsiNet.
